Date range filtering in Dashboards, Prompts, and Citations


We’re adding the ability to filter date ranges throughout Scrunch.

You’ll now be able to view data for the last 7 days, the last 4 weeks, or the last 12 weeks (default) in Dashboards and Prompts views. We’ll show only data for the selected time range.

As you select larger or smaller date ranges, Scrunch will automatically show historical and trend data with more or less granularity — for example, in a “current week” view, you’ll see daily data points in historical and trend charts. In larger date ranges, you’ll see weekly (rolling 7-day) data points.

Simpler, more consistent metrics throughout the product

We’ve heard your feedback that there are too many metric definitions in Scrunch — e.g., depending on the view, we’ve shown metrics reflecting historical performance, the last 7 days, or the most recent data updated. With our upcoming release, metrics are now computed simply and consistently as average performance over the selected date range.

Historical / trend data is still available in line charts and sparklines throughout the the product. If you need to compare metrics for two different time periods, it’s as simple as opening another tab and changing the date range filter.

Clearer and consistent terms for Citation tracking


tl;dr: We’re renaming the Sources view to Citations, and standardizing on “Citations” terminology throughout the platform.


The Citations view lets you analyze the most influential sites and individual URLs driving presence & clickthroughs in AI search engines. We’ve found that the term “Citations” is more understandable for this data.

Additionally, inside the Citations view, we’re renaming the following metrics to better represent what they’re tracking. The metric calculation remains the same as previously.

  • % Seen is now Citation Consistency

  • Index is now Influence Score

Account management improvements for customers


In addition to new features for Topic Volume, Trends, Site Audit, and Insights, we’ve improved scalability for customers who are managing multiple clients, brands, or lines of business. These updates will begin rolling out the week of September 8th.

Unified admin view for enterprises & agencies

For organizations with multiple brands managed in Scrunch, we’re rolling out a centralized admin console that offers more flexibility for managing your brands, team members, permissions, and API access in Scrunch — in one central location.

Read-only permissions and guest users in Scrunch

We’re adding a “Viewer” permission so you can invite additional team members into Scrunch who should be able to analyze data, but not change your Scrunch configuration.
New portal for developers and integration support

We’re adding more documentation for the Scrunch API and integrations based on it, as well as additional documentation for our Bot Analytics and Agent Experience Platform products.
